You had mentioned before that you were interested in some smaller sets, there were some great small sets back in the late 90's that were really geared for kids, (brightly colored, really animated style) No inserts, but only about 50 cards sets. Marvel Vision was one, and I think there were two sets call Marvel Spiderman 99 cent'rs and Marvel X-men 99 cent'rs....again, no inserts, but really pretty nice. Also the Marvel/Fleer Cartoon network set has a section made up of like 10-12 cards that were taken from the X-man and Spiderman animated series.....
